Diagnostic value of modern non-invasive methods of peripheral vitreoretinal interface in the choice of treatment tactics of patients with valvular ruptures of the retina

The article presents the results of research of the peripheral vitreoretinal interface in 46 patients with valvular ruptures of the retina based on modern non-invasive diagnostic techniques. Various clinical variations of vitreous fixation to the retinal flap were revealed. According to the obtained data, the differential approach to laser treatment was determined.
Key words: vitreoretinal interface, valvular ruptures of the retina, vitreal traction strands.
